Professor Patrick Honohan:

First, done and dusted is an over-interpretation of my statement, about which I would urge the Deputy to be careful. I must also be careful what I say here. The design definitely would be very advantageous to Ireland.

It definitely would be very advantageous to Ireland. While it will not change the debt on day one, it would allow a slower and better path to the debt going forward. Any transaction that involves a lengthening of maturities could end up adding lots more years of interest but if the interest rates are sufficiently low, then that is also advantageous. One should not worry on that score. I acknowledge that last year’s arrangement was not of great advantage, although it was slightly advantageous to Ireland, but that was because it was part of a wider solution.
